Sorry guys and gals. i have been super busy! just wanted to share a update. we had lots of fun and the family got some nice bucks. Opening day had my uncle, one cousin and grandma tag out. a 2x3 4x5 4x4 then sunday my wife got her buck and my other cousin got his buck. 3x3 and a 4x4, then yesterday my little bro got his buck a 4x4. did not get out today, had to much work to do. I still have my multi tag so i will be looking around for a toad! :drool: have a few hunter a little bit later to take out on some of my leases and see if we can;t get them into some deer. 6 bucks in 3 days is pretty sweet. deer numbers are down and not seeing a ton of deer. A lot of smaller bucks. most all my family was just looking for some meat. my one cousin got a a very nice 4x4 older buck with good mass. he was already rutted up. he had a huge neck on him and was a sticky buck "from urinating on his back legs". all the others were pretty mild. here is a pic of my little Bro's buck. and then my wifes buck with all the heads of the other bucks, but the bigger 4x4. i did not get a pic of it. i will email and see if i can get a pic from my uncle.

no i ment sticky :chuckle: from piss all over his back legs on his sent glands :chuckle: the bucks get a very sticky residue on there legs and stink at the same time, when they start rutting and marking.
